Can we someone give me the path or location of the Icons Folder?

Generally, there are not separate icons (*.ico) files for programs -
icons are contained in the *.exe file for the particular program.

However, there are more icons in the files shell32.dll and
moricons.dll.

However, You can create your own icons (*ico) files from jpg images
using programs like Irfanview (free).
